Hear our wide-ranging and interesting chat we had with actor and playwright Jason Phillips. Find out the irony behind him getting into the theater industry, his thoughts on how improv productions are most successful, and his daring and creative initiative he implemented during COVID with Magnetic Theater. Then we chatted about his many, many performances coming up including at the Appalachian Playwriting Festival, Parkway Playhouse and the Hendersonville Theatre, as well as his unique insight into preparing for an improv role in Adesto Theatre’s “Jane Austen Improv.”
Jason Phillips, Actor/Playwright
Host: Janet Kopenhaver
Original Air Date: September 11, 2025
